Output 584dd03a10a6afebddb8794d4aeac920b071ad76dccec48245644c3abf1be0f9:2

value
50823
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56bf24c29c9e77780e28929b4355bf1e621189e0 OP_EQUALVERIFY OP_CHECKSIG
address
18ug6PTXGj7EqHV7cKkP7uycVcGYrkgdhz
transaction
584dd03a10a6afebddb8794d4aeac920b071ad76dccec48245644c3abf1be0f9
confirmations
524120
spent
true